硬件仿真技术:验证工程师的新宠,超越RTL模拟器

0 下载量 91 浏览量 更新于2024-08-30 收藏 354KB PDF 举报
随着科技的进步,硬件仿真技术在现代设计中的地位日益凸显,特别是在系统层面的设计中。它不仅允许设计师使用寄存器传输级(RTL)源代码作为基础模型,而且还提供了强大的处理能力,使得软件开发和运行大型工作负载成为可能。这一技术的发展使得硬件仿真逐渐取代了传统的RTL模拟器,后者在早期设计阶段因其快速编译和交互式分析而无可替代,尤其是在处理小型设计时。 然而,硬件仿真并非全然替代RTL模拟器。在系统集成和验证测试中,尤其是需要同时测试软硬件的场景,硬件仿真由于速度限制,对于大容量设计显得过于缓慢,例如,对一个1亿等效门的ASIC进行实时仿真可能会耗费大量时间。这正是为什么仿真数据中心应运而生的重要原因。它旨在解决大规模、并发以及远程访问的需求,以提高验证效率。 仿真数据中心的核心要素包括: 1. 强大的设计容量:为了适应不断增长的设计复杂度,数据中心需要具备处理几亿甚至更多ASIC等效门的能力,以满足大型系统设计的需要。 2. 多用户并发支持:为了满足多个验证工程师和软件开发人员同时工作的需求,数据中心必须具有高效的资源管理和并发处理功能,确保效率和资源的有效利用。 3. 远程访问:考虑到全球化的项目协作,数据中心需提供便捷的远程访问方式,无论工程师身处何地,都能实时接入并使用共享的仿真资源。 总结来说,硬件仿真技术的兴起改变了设计验证的方式,它在系统级设计中的应用显著提高了效率。尽管如此,它并未完全淘汰传统模拟器,而是形成了互补。仿真数据中心的出现,通过提供强大、灵活和高效的环境,解决了大规模设计验证中的关键挑战,成为了验证工程师的福音。同时,随着技术的持续进步,未来仿真技术将更加成熟,进一步优化设计验证流程。